Many fan-made rips use lossy audio (AAC or MP3 at 192kbps) to save space. A true high-quality 1080p BluRay Dual Audio release will retain AC-3 5.1 (640kbps) or DTS (1.5 Mbps) for the primary track. If you see "Dual Audio" but the file is only 1.5GB, the audio has been heavily compressed.

The 2009 reboot, simply titled Fast & Furious, is the bridge that turned a street-racing series into a global action juggernaut. ⚡ The Verdict
This film is the "essential pivot." It ditches the standalone feel of the previous sequels to reunite the original four: Dom, Brian, Letty, and Mia. While it lacks the sheer scale of the later films, it establishes the "family" stakes that define the franchise. 🎥 Production & Visuals (1080p BluRay)
Visual Fidelity: The 1080p transfer excels in the desert chase and the dark tunnel sequences.

CGI vs. Practical: Features more practical stunt work than the newest entries, giving the cars a heavy, dangerous feel.
Audio: The Dual Audio tracks are a treat for fans; the engine roars and the reggaeton-heavy soundtrack pop in high-definition surround sound. 🏎️ Key Highlights
The Reunion: Seeing Diesel and Walker back together after eight years provides instant chemistry.
The Opening: The liquid gold tanker heist in the Dominican Republic is a series high point.
The Tunnels: A claustrophobic, high-speed finale that feels like a video game in the best way.
